This video is a recording of the East Brunswick Board of Education meeting held on September 25, 2025. The meeting officially begins with a roll call and a pledge of allegiance. The board then discusses and votes on two major items: the revised resignation of Superintendent Dr. Victor Veleski and the appointment of Dr. Evelyn Meon as the new superintendent. The majority of the meeting is dedicated to the discussion and explanation surrounding the hiring of Dr. Meon, including the terms of her contract and the search process. The meeting concludes with a brief mention of a curriculum item related to a field trip and public comment.
The transcript mentions that Dr. Meon has a strong educational background, curriculum expertise, and leadership skills. Several board members highlighted her enthusiasm, willingness to confront obstacles, and innovative thinking as key strengths. They also noted her focus on relationship building and her commitment to putting "students first." While specific details of her past roles aren't provided, the board's discussion indicates she was seen as highly qualified and a strong fit for the district's needs.
